It’s not clear when Owen finds time to enjoy the outdoors these days. Recently, he has been busy singing about families. He just took fans behind the scenes of his hit music video, which earned a CMA Music Video of the Year nomination.
Owen’s chart-topping country single “Homemade” is an ode to families and small-town values. And stories from his family are important to Owen. His music video tells the tale of his grandparents’ courtship. As the Tennessean reported, it’s a long story with a happy ending.
Owen has a daughter, Pearl, with Lacey Buchanan. The couple divorced in 2015.

The Eli Young Band has come a long way from its humble beginnings at the University of North Texas. The group, which was originally a duo composed of Eli and James Young, put out their first record in 2002. Since then, they’ve released six full-length albums and multiple singles and compilations.
Eli told Eat Play Rock in 2019 that work often gets in the way of family. When they get a month off, he said, they spend it celebrating holidays and enjoying some family time.
“A whole lotta Christmas and some traveling and family and those things that we’ve been neglecting too much over the first [part] of the year,” he said, when asked what he’d do with some time off. “So we’ll be playing some catch up will be a lot of with that.”
